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Звiт по преддипл.doc
Скачиваний:
1
Добавлен:
01.05.2025
Размер:
333.82 Кб
Скачать

2 Загальна частина

2.1 Вимоги до технічних засобів, що застосовуються

Технічні вимоги до комп'ютера повинні відповідати мінімальним системним вимогам для розробки і експлуатації створюваної програми. Ці вимоги приведені для всіх використовуваних програмних засобів.

Вимоги до складу і параметрів технічних засобів.

Система повинна працювати на ІBM-сумісних персональних комп'ютерах.

Мінімальна конфігурація:

  • тип процесора Pentіum III 800 і вище;

  • обсяг оперативного запам'ятовуючого пристрою 64 Мб і більше;

  • обсяг вільного місця на жорсткому диску 5 Мб;

  • звукова карта сумісна з DirectX 8 або вище;

  • маніпулятори мишка та клавіатура.

Конфігурація, що рекомендується:

  • тип процесора Pentіum ІV 1,4 і вище;

  • обсяг оперативного запам'ятовуючого пристрою 128 Мб і більше;

  • обсяг вільного місця на жорсткому диску 20 Мб;

  • звукова карта сумісна з DirectX 8 або вище;

  • маніпулятори мишка та клавіатура.

Вимоги до програмної сумісності.

Програма повинна працювати під керуванням сімейства операційних систем Wіn32 (Wіndows 2000/МЕ/ХР/Vista/7/8 і т.п.).

2.2 Опис інструментальних засобів, що застосовуються

Для розробки програми було обране інтегроване середовище розробки C++ Builder з використанням пакету Borland C++ Builder 6.

C++ Builder – програмний продукт, який являє собою інструмент швидкої розробки додатків (RAD), інтегроване середовище програмування (IDE), система, яка використовується програмістами для розробки програмного забезпечення на мові програмування C++.

C++ Builder містить інструменти, які за допомогою drag-and-drop дійсно роблять розробку візуальною, спрощують програмування завдяки вбудованому WYSIWYG-редактору інтерфейсу і таке інше.

Програмування в Borland C++ Builder складається з двох основних етапів:

  1. Візуальна побудова програми на основі об’єктних компонентів та налаштування їх властивостей, в результаті чого можна швидко сформувати інтерфейс користувача та забезпечити значну долю функціональності додатку.

  2. Написання програмного коду на мові Object С Builder для забезпечення особливої функціональності додатку, котру неможливо досягнути використанням візуальної побудови.

ВИСНОВОК

Під час роботи над дипломним проектом на тему «Розробка автоматизації ведення та управління базами даних магазину квітів» засобами середовища C++Builder було створено програмній продукт, що дає можливість автоматизувати ведення і управління баз даних, за рахунок автоматичного відстеження характеристик квітів та основуючись на цим видавати потрібні звіти, здійснювати пошуки та ввести бухгалтерію.

Розроблений програмний продукт розрахований на використання у спеціалізованих магазинах по продажу квітів та для забезпечення зручності роботи працівників і магазину.

Розроблене програмне забезпечення має зрозумілий тематичній інтерфейс та організацію необхідних функцій для зручної та комфортної роботи користувача.

Також програмний продукт може бути вдосконалений за рахунок додавання функцій, таких як:

  • видавання звітів необхідних для відстеження руху товару;

  • розширення бази даних за рахунок додавання більшого асортименту;

  • відстеження терміну гідності свіжих квітів;

  • створення глобальних гарячих клавіш для управління програмою.

Розроблений програмний продукт у повному обсязі виконує усі функції, задані у постановці задачі.

СПИСОК ЛІТЕРАТУРИ

  1. Павловская, Т.А.. С/С++. Программирование на языке высокого уровня[Текст]/Т.А. Павловская Москва-Санкт-Петербург: ПИТЕР, 2004.-460 с.

  2. Хоменко, А.Д. Работа с базами данных в C++ Builder [Текст] /Хоменко А.Д., Ададуров С.Е.;Санкт-Петербург: БХВ-Петербург, 2006.-496 с.

  3. Архангельский, А.Я. Программирование в C++ Builder 6 [Текст] / А.Я. Архангельский. М.: Бином, 2003.-1152 с.

  4. КалвертЧарли, РейсдорфКент. Borland C++ Builder. Энциклопедия программирования. [Текст] / КалвертЧарли, РейсдорфКент. – М.: ООО “ДиаСофтЮП”, 2005. –1008 с.

  5. Боровский, Андрей. Самоучитель С++ и С++ Builder [Текст] / Андрей Боровский. ─ Москва Санкт-Петербург-Киев: ПИТЕР, 2005.-255 с.

  6. Культин, Н. Б. С/С++ в примерах и задачах [Текст] / Н. Б. Культин. – СПб.: БХВ – Петербург, 2001. – 288 с.

  7. Культин, Никита. Самоучитель С++ Builder [Текст] / Никита Культин. ─ Санкт-Петербург: БХВ-Петербург, 2004.-316 с.

  8. Архангельский, А.Я. Язык С++ Builder. Справочное и методическое пособие. [Текст] / А.Я.Архангельский.М.: Бином, 2008.-942 с.

  9. Лаптев, В.В. С++. Объектно-ориентированное программирование. Задачи и упражнения. [Текст] /В.В. Лаптев, А.В. Морозов, А.В. Бокова; Москва-Санкт-Петербург: ПИТЕР, 2007.-287 с.

  10. Павловская, Т.А. С++. Объектно-ориентированное программирование. Практикум. [Текст] / Ю.А. Щупак, Т.А. Павловская. Москва-Санкт-Петербург: ПИТЕР, 2008.-264 с.

  11. Пахомов, Борис. С++ и С++ Builder [Текст] / Борис Пахомов. ─Санкт-Петербург: БХВ-Петербург, 2008.-672 с.